| Obverse description | The upper field features the official expo logo composed of three overlapping circles in relief. Below, the legend 'DESIGN EXPO '89' appears in bold incuse lettering, with 'NAGOYA JAPAN' in a smaller legend beneath. A small Japanese mint mark appears in the lower exergue. |

| Reverse description | The reverse displays a stylised emblem combining a drawn bow with a nocked arrow crossing it horizontally, forming a design suggestive of the letter 'D'. The motif is set within a beaded border encircling the entire field, with decorative cloud or flame elements at the top and base of the bow. |
